Career path

Cyber Crime Specialist Roles (UK) Description
Cyber Security Analyst (Cyber Crime Investigation) Investigates cybercrime incidents, analyses malware, and provides incident response. High demand.
Digital Forensics Specialist (Cybercrime) Collects, preserves, and analyses digital evidence in cybercrime investigations. Strong future prospects.
Cybercrime Intelligence Analyst Analyzes threat intelligence, identifies emerging cybercrime trends, and supports proactive security measures. Growing sector.
Certified Ethical Hacker (Cybercrime Focus) Conducts penetration testing and vulnerability assessments to identify security weaknesses. High earning potential.
Cybercrime Investigator (Law Enforcement) Works with law enforcement agencies to investigate and prosecute cybercriminals. Excellent career progression.
